How to Style Men’s Shirts Casually?
Styling men’s shirts casually is all about balance and versatility. Opt for a relaxed-fit button-down or an Oxford shirt and leave it untucked over jeans or chinos for an effortless look. Rolling up the sleeves adds a laid-back feel, making it perfect for weekend outings. For a more modern touch, layer an open shirt over a fitted t-shirt or wear a printed short-sleeve shirt with tailored shorts. Sticking to neutral or pastel tones keeps the outfit versatile, while bolder prints or flannel patterns add personality.
What Are the Different Types of Men’s Shirts?
Men’s shirts come in various styles, each suited to different occasions. Dress shirts are tailored for formal events and business settings, often featuring stiff collars and structured fits. Casual shirts, such as Oxford and flannel shirts, are more relaxed and versatile for everyday wear. Polo shirts offer a blend of smart and casual, ideal for business-casual settings. Henley shirts provide a more rugged and sporty aesthetic with their buttoned placket. Linen shirts are lightweight and breathable, perfect for warm-weather styling.
How to Wear a Men’s Shirt for Formal Occasions?
For formal occasions, a well-fitted dress shirt is essential. Stick to classic colors like white, light blue, or pale pink, which pair well with suits or tailored trousers. A spread or point collar works best with a tie, while a French cuff with cufflinks adds a refined touch. Ensure the shirt is neatly pressed and tucked in to maintain a polished look. For black-tie events, a crisp white dress shirt with a structured collar is the best choice, often paired with a tuxedo.
What Are the Best Colors for Men’s Shirts?
The best colors for men’s shirts depend on the occasion and personal style. Classic neutrals like white, black, and navy are wardrobe staples, offering versatility for both casual and formal wear. Light blue and pastel shades add a refined touch and work well in business settings. Earthy tones like olive, beige, and brown bring warmth and pair effortlessly with chinos and denim. Bold hues such as burgundy, mustard, or emerald green can make a statement when styled correctly.
How to Style Men’s Shirts for the Office?
For a professional office look, choose structured Oxford or dress shirts in solid colors or subtle patterns. Pairing them with tailored trousers and a leather belt creates a refined appearance. Keeping the shirt tucked in ensures a polished, business-ready outfit. Layering with a blazer or a lightweight knit sweater adds sophistication while maintaining comfort. Avoid overly bright colors or bold prints in corporate settings, instead opting for muted tones like navy, grey, or pastels for a professional and modern aesthetic.
